🤖 Artificial Intelligence in Medical Coding

Misconceptions and Realities: The Notion of artificial intelligence (AI) replacing human coders has circulated for years. However, the reality remains far more nuanced. While AI offers efficiency in certain aspects, its capacity to comprehend the nuances of medical documentation is limited.

Limitations of AI in Medical Coding: AI's efficacy hinges on standardized data inputs, yet medical documentation varies vastly. Providers express themselves uniquely, and AI struggles to decipher context and intent accurately.

🌍 Globalization and Outsourcing in Medical Coding

Impact of Outsourcing on Accuracy: While outsourcing may offer cost benefits, it introduces complexities in maintaining coding accuracy. Language barriers and cultural nuances pose significant challenges to offshore coding endeavors.

Challenges with Overseas Coding: Offshore coding initiatives often encounter discrepancies and errors due to linguistic and cultural disparities. The cost-saving allure of outsourcing must be weighed against its potential ramifications on data integrity.
